I found this question in an archived General Discussion UO House of Commons chat log, stored by Stratics, dated December 2, 1999.

This excerpt seems to corroborate my memory.
Glamdring - *Z|ggy* Have you ever thought about removing the "I wish to honor thee" or make it so that it doesnt give others karma...its rather annoying for the few Dreads out there to have someone ruin your titel =)
Sage - Yes. We wil probably have a solution for this soon.
SunSword - just say we need to add a confirmation
SunSword - Heheh
